Northrop Grumman is hiring an Industrial Engineer to support our Tactical Space Systems Division located in Gilbert, AZ. The Principal Industrial Engineer analyzes and designs sequence of operations and workflow to improve efficiencies in plant and production facilities and equipment layouts; and establishes methods for maximum utilization of production facilities and personnel. Conducts studies pertaining to cost control, cost reduction, inventory control, and production record systems. On the basis of these studies, develops and implements plans and programs for facility modifications and revisions to operating methods.

Duties/Responsibilities:

  • Helps determine the most efficient sequence of operations and workflow and provides finite scheduling to manufacturing cost centers and IPTs

  • Maintains datasets and generates metrics that provide for the measurement of program & functional schedule & cost performance.

  • Develops and deploys plans that ensure the timely availability and effective utilization of labor, facilities, equipment, & tooling resources enabling the achievement of program delivery and cost milestones.

  • Develops and summarizes analyses for the acquisition, maintenance & enhancement of capital assets and miscellaneous equipment. Plans plant, office, and production facilities and equipment layouts

  • Provides capacity planning and rate tool analyses

  • Conducts studies pertaining to cost control, cost reduction and inventory control

  • Establish or assist in establishing accident prevention measures and may manage training programs for personnel concerning all phases of production operations.

  • May assist facilities engineers in the planning and design of facilities.
